Applications

Accélérez votre site WordPress

WordPress est une plateforme de gestion de contenu (CMS) open source qui offre une grande flexibilité et une multitude de fonctionnalités pour la création de sites web. Cependant, la vitesse de chargement d’un site WordPress peut parfois poser problème, surtout avec l’ajout de nombreux plugins, de thèmes complexes ou d’images lourdes. Pour optimiser la vitesse de votre site WordPress, plusieurs stratégies peuvent être mises en œuvre.

Tout d’abord, il est essentiel de choisir un bon hébergeur web. Un hébergement de qualité, avec des serveurs rapides et fiables, est un élément clé pour garantir des temps de chargement rapides. Les hébergeurs spécialisés dans WordPress, tels que SiteGround, Kinsta ou WP Engine, offrent souvent des performances supérieures et des fonctionnalités spécifiquement conçues pour WordPress.

Ensuite, optimisez les images de votre site. Les images non optimisées sont l’une des principales raisons de la lenteur des sites WordPress. Utilisez des outils de compression d’images tels que WP Smush ou Imagify pour réduire la taille des fichiers sans compromettre la qualité visuelle. De plus, utilisez le format adéquat (JPEG pour les photographies, PNG pour les illustrations et les logos) et spécifiez des dimensions appropriées pour les images afin d’éviter le chargement d’images plus grandes que nécessaire.

En ce qui concerne les plugins, limitez leur nombre et choisissez-les avec soin. Chaque plugin ajouté à votre site peut potentiellement ralentir les performances, surtout s’ils effectuent des requêtes vers des bases de données externes ou chargent des scripts supplémentaires. Désactivez et supprimez les plugins inutiles et recherchez des alternatives légères ou des solutions intégrées pour certaines fonctionnalités.

Une autre astuce consiste à utiliser un thème léger et optimisé pour les performances. Les thèmes complexes et surchargés de fonctionnalités peuvent ralentir considérablement votre site. Optez pour des thèmes bien codés, qui utilisent efficacement les technologies modernes telles que HTML5, CSS3 et JavaScript asynchrone. Des frameworks comme Genesis ou GeneratePress sont réputés pour leur légèreté et leur rapidité.

Le cache est également un élément crucial pour accélérer WordPress. Les plugins de mise en cache, tels que WP Rocket, W3 Total Cache ou WP Super Cache, peuvent considérablement réduire les temps de chargement en générant des versions statiques de vos pages et en les servant aux visiteurs sans nécessiter de traitement dynamique à chaque requête.

Optimisez également votre base de données en supprimant régulièrement les éléments inutiles tels que les révisions d’articles, les brouillons et les commentaires spam. Les plugins comme WP-Optimize ou WP-Sweep peuvent automatiser ce processus et maintenir votre base de données propre et efficace.

Enfin, utilisez un réseau de diffusion de contenu (CDN) pour distribuer votre contenu statique (images, CSS, JavaScript) à partir de serveurs situés dans le monde entier, ce qui réduit la distance physique entre les utilisateurs et les serveurs, améliorant ainsi la vitesse de chargement pour tous les visiteurs, peu importe leur emplacement géographique.

En mettant en œuvre ces différentes stratégies, vous pouvez significativement accélérer votre site WordPress, offrant ainsi une meilleure expérience utilisateur et potentiellement améliorant votre classement dans les moteurs de recherche, car la vitesse de chargement est un facteur important dans l’algorithme de Google.

Plus de connaissances

Bien sûr, voici des détails supplémentaires sur chaque stratégie pour accélérer un site WordPress :

  1. Choisir un bon hébergeur web :

    • Optez pour un hébergement spécialisé dans WordPress, car ils sont souvent optimisés pour les performances de cette plateforme.
    • Recherchez des hébergeurs qui offrent des fonctionnalités telles que la mise en cache intégrée, la compression de fichiers et des serveurs optimisés pour les charges de travail WordPress.
    • Vérifiez les avis d’autres utilisateurs et les performances passées de l’hébergeur en termes de temps de disponibilité et de vitesse de chargement.
  2. Optimiser les images :

    • Utilisez des outils de compression d’images pour réduire leur taille sans compromettre la qualité visuelle. Cela réduira le temps de chargement des pages.
    • Activez la mise en cache des images sur le navigateur pour que les visiteurs n’aient pas à télécharger les mêmes images à chaque visite.
    • Utilisez des formats d’image modernes tels que WebP, qui offrent une meilleure compression que JPEG ou PNG.
  3. Gérer les plugins avec précaution :

    • Limitez le nombre de plugins installés sur votre site en ne gardant que ceux qui sont vraiment nécessaires.
    • Assurez-vous que les plugins que vous utilisez sont régulièrement mis à jour et compatibles avec la dernière version de WordPress.
    • Évitez les plugins volumineux qui ajoutent beaucoup de fonctionnalités non utilisées à votre site.
  4. Utiliser un thème léger et bien codé :

    • Choisissez un thème optimisé pour les performances et qui utilise les meilleures pratiques de codage.
    • Évitez les thèmes trop complexes avec des fonctionnalités superflues. Optez pour des thèmes simples et élégants qui se chargent rapidement.
  5. Mettre en cache les pages :

    • Utilisez un plugin de mise en cache pour générer des versions statiques de vos pages et les servir aux visiteurs. Cela réduit la charge sur le serveur et accélère le chargement des pages.
    • Configurez le plugin de mise en cache pour qu’il gère également la mise en cache des ressources statiques telles que les images, les fichiers CSS et JavaScript.
  6. Optimiser la base de données :

    • Supprimez régulièrement les éléments inutiles de la base de données, tels que les révisions d’articles, les brouillons et les commentaires spam.
    • Utilisez des plugins d’optimisation de base de données pour automatiser ce processus et garder votre base de données propre et efficace.
  7. Utiliser un réseau de diffusion de contenu (CDN) :

    • Intégrez un CDN à votre site WordPress pour distribuer votre contenu statique (images, CSS, JavaScript) à partir de serveurs situés dans le monde entier.
    • Un CDN réduit la distance physique entre les utilisateurs et les serveurs, améliorant ainsi la vitesse de chargement pour tous les visiteurs.

En appliquant ces stratégies de manière méthodique, vous pouvez considérablement accélérer votre site WordPress et offrir une meilleure expérience utilisateur à vos visiteurs.

Bouton retour en haut de la page